BotCon 2013 Rainmakers Set Revealed: Sunstorm, Bitstream and Hotlink

Transformers News: BotCon 2013 Rainmakers Set Revealed: Sunstorm, Bitstream and Hotlink

Thursday, June 27th, 2013 8:10PM CDT

Categories: Toy News, Event News, Auctions
Posted by: LOST Cybertronian   Views: 45,532

Topic Options: View Discussion · Sign in or Join to reply

Posted on the Official BotCon Facebook page, we get a look at the BotCon 2013 Rainmakers set. First reported here as a rumour, we now have confirmation that these rainmakers do use the classics Starscream mold.

  • Sunstorm
  • Bitstream
  • Hotlink

There is still a rather big misunderstanding when fans talk of "mold degredation." Yes, a mold will degrade and eventually break after so many uses, but new ones can be made again and again. Everything is designed on computer now, so the original data is seldom lost. The question of if a mold gets remade as more to do with if the price of recasting the mold will be offset by the sale of the new product. If not, it may not be done. In the case of the Classics Seeker mold(s), they get used so extensively that Hasbro/Takara are almost sure to make their money back and then some each time they recast a new mold to produce more product.
